CentOS 7网卡网桥、绑定设置

本文详细介绍了在Linux环境下如何进行网卡桥接和绑定设置。包括网卡配置文件的编辑,如设置设备类型、启动协议、桥接名称等;以及网桥配置文件的编辑,涵盖静态IP地址、子网掩码、网关、DNS等内容。同时,还介绍了如何通过配置实现网卡绑定,提高网络连接的稳定性和速度。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

来源:https://www.cnblogs.com/configure/p/5799538.html 作者:– 烂笔头 –

一、网卡桥接设置

1、网卡配置文件:

[root@localhost /]# vim /etc/sysconfig/network-scripts/ifcfg-enp8s0
TYPE=Ethernet
DEVICE=enp8s0
NAME=enp8s0
BOOTPROTO=none
ONBOOT=yes
BRIDGE=br0

2、网桥配置文件:

[root@localhost /]# vim /etc/sysconfig/network-scripts/ifcfg-br0
TYPE=Bridge
DEVICE=br0
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.1.200
NETMASK=255.255.255.0
GATEWAY=192.168.1.1
DNS1=114.114.114.114

二、网卡绑定设置

1、网卡配置文件01:
[root@localhost /]# vim /etc/sysconfig/network-scripts/ifcfg-enp6s0f0
TYPE=Ethernet
DEVICE=enp6s0f0
NAME=enp6s0f0
BOOTPROTO=none
ONBOOT=yes
USERCTL=no
MASTER=bond0
SLAVE=yes

2、网卡配置文件02:
[root@localhost /]# vim /etc/sysconfig/network-scripts/ifcfg-enp6s0f1
TYPE=Ethernet
DEVICE=enp6s0f1
NAME=enp6s0f1
BOOTPROTO=none
ONBOOT=yes
USERCTL=no
MASTER=bond0
SLAVE=yes

3、网桥配置文件:

[root@localhost /]# vim /etc/sysconfig/network-scripts/ifcfg-bond0
TYPE=Ethernet
DEVICE=bond0
BOOTPROTO=static
ONBOOT=yes
USERCTL=no
IPADDR=172.16.1.216
NETMASK=255.255.255.0
GATEWAY=172.16.1.1
DNS1=114.114.114.114

### VMware 中 CentOS 7 桥接模式网络设置 在 VMware 虚拟化环境中,当尝试将 CentOS 7 配置为桥接模式时,可能会遇到无法正常联网的情况。以下是针对该问题的具体解决方案: #### 1. 确认虚拟网络适配器配置 在 VMware 的 **Edit -> Virtual Network Editor** 中确认已启用桥接模式,并将其绑定到物理网卡上[^1]。如果自动检测(Automatic)能够识别并分配合适的物理网卡,则可以直接使用此选项。 #### 2. 修改虚拟机中的网络接口配置文件 通过 `vi` 命令编辑 `/etc/sysconfig/network-scripts/ifcfg-<interface>` 文件,其中 `<interface>` 表示实际的网卡名称(例如 ens33)。以下是典型的配置参数及其含义[^3][^4]: ```bash TYPE=Ethernet # 网络类型为以太网 PROXY_METHOD=none # 不使用代理方法 BROWSER_ONLY=no # 浏览器不单独处理 BOOTPROTO=static # 设置为静态IP地址分配方式 DEFROUTE=yes # 默认路由允许 IPV4_FAILURE_FATAL=no # IPv4失败时不致命错误 IPV6INIT=yes # 启用IPv6初始化 IPV6_AUTOCONF=yes # 自动配置IPv6 IPV6_DEFROUTE=yes # 默认路由适用于IPv6 IPV6_FAILURE_FATAL=no # IPv6失败时不致命错误 NAME=<interface> # 接口名称 (如ens33) UUID=<generated_uuid> # 自动生成的唯一标识符(无需修改) DEVICE=<interface> # 设备名 (如ens33) ONBOOT=yes # 开机启动时激活设备 IPADDR=<host_ip_in_same_subnet> # 分配给虚拟机的IP地址(需与宿主机在同一子网下) NETMASK=255.255.255.0 # 子网掩码 GATEWAY=<gateway_of_host_network> # 主机所在网络的网关 DNS1=<dns_server_address> # DNS服务器地址(可选为主机网关) ``` 确保上述字段均按照实际情况进行了调整,特别是 `IPADDR`, `NETMASK`, 和 `GATEWAY` 字段应匹配宿主机所在的局域网环境[^4]。 #### 3. 应用新的网络配置 完成以上更改之后,重启网络服务使新设定生效: ```bash sudo systemctl restart network ``` 或者重新加载特定网卡的服务: ```bash sudo ifdown <interface> sudo ifup <interface> ``` 验证网络状态是否恢复正常: ```bash ping www.google.com ``` 如果没有返回任何数据包丢失的信息,则说明桥接模式已经成功配置[^2]。 --- 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值